After months of rumors and even a website slip-up that briefly gave the game away, RGG Studio has officially lifted the curtain on Yakuza Kiwami 3. The remake of the 2009 PlayStation 3 entry has been rebuilt from the ground up in the modern Dragon Engine, and the debut trailer has already sparked plenty of conversation among long-time fans.

A Full Remake, Not Just a Touch-Up

Unlike the lightly remastered version that arrived during the PS4 era, Kiwami 3 promises a complete reimagining. Combat, visuals, and even narrative presentation have been brought in line with recent Like a Dragon titles. Early footage shows Kamurocho and Ryukyu shimmering with neon and atmosphere, while character models carry the same fidelity seen in Like a Dragon: Infinite Wealth.

A New Story to Explore

Alongside the main remake, RGG is packaging an all-new side story called Yakuza 3: Dark Ties. This additional campaign focuses on Yoshitaka Mine, a fan-favorite antagonist whose cold and calculating demeanor made him stand out in the original. Dark Ties aims to flesh out his rise through the underworld, offering players the chance to step into his shoes for the first time.

Another significant change comes in the acting department. The remake will feature full Japanese and English voice tracks, complete with modern facial capture for more nuanced performances. Veteran actor Teruyuki Kagawa has also joined the cast, portraying Go Hamazaki in a role that looks to add more weight to the character.

The story once again moves between the bustling streets of Kamurocho and the laid-back charm of Okinawa’s Ryukyu district. Long-time fans will recognize these locales, but the fresh coat of paint and new side activities should give returning players plenty of reasons to get lost all over again.

Release Date and Platforms

Yakuza Kiwami 3 and Dark Ties will release together on February 12, 2026. The package will be available on PlayStation 4, P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X|S, PC via Steam, and the newly announced Nintendo Switch 2.

With the first two Kiwami remakes already beloved by fans, expectations are high for this latest re-entry. By bringing in fresh story content, modern technology, and a commitment to overhauling the weaker elements of the original game, RGG Studio is making a strong case that Kiwami 3 will be more than just a nostalgia trip it might finally give Yakuza 3 the redemption arc it has long deserved.
